Golden Eagles Use Late Rally to Down Utes, 6-4

The Basics
Score:  Utah 4 – Oral Roberts 6
Records: Utah (0-2) – ORU (2-0)
Location: Tulsa, Okla. (J.L. Johnson Stadium)

 

TULSA, Okla. – Spencer Henson and Jared Montoya delivered RBI doubles in a four-run seventh inning that propelled the Oral Roberts baseball team to a 6-4, come-from-behind win over Utah Saturday afternoon at J.L. Johnson Stadium.

 

The Golden Eagles erased a three-run deficit as Henson and Montoya doubled into right and left field, respectively, and Jack Rosenberg and Cal Hernandez added RBIs. ORU had six of its first seven batters reach base safely in the rally, while the only out of the run came with a RBI as it battled back to score four times on four hits.

 

ORU picked up its second win from a newcomer to the bullpen as Tanner Rogen earned the victory on the mound, while Kyler Stout added his second save in as many chance throwing a perfect ninth inning.

 

Quote of the Game

"We had some good at-bats late and hopefully that made up for some of the bad at-bats early in the game. We struggled offensively for about five innings there before we were able to settle in. We finally got our feet underneath us and made a good run there at the end. And I thought that Andrew Pace's at-bat in the eighth inning was important to stretch the lead." – Head Coach Ryan Folmar

 

Turning Point

As Utah started to find some offense in the middle innings, it took a 4-1 lead into the bottom of the seventh. Trevor McCutchin and Riley Keizor started the momentum for ORU with free bases before Henson's RBI double to the wall in right. Rosenberg tallied a RBI groundout and Montoya followed with a RBI double, his first hit as a Golden Eagle, to even the score, 4-4. Hernandez put across the go-ahead run with a single and the bullpen made the margin stand.

 

Inside the Box Score
- Keizor continued his blistering start for ORU going 2-for-3 with two runs scored and a walk.

 

- Hernandez was not only effective on offense going 2-for-3, he was even more spectacular on defense, coming up with web gems at third base to keep the Golden Eagles in the ballgame early.

 

- Andrew Pace added an insurance run in the bottom of the eighth in his first plate appearance as a Golden Eagle, coming up with a pinch-hit, RBI single.

 

- Rotola put ORU on the board in the fourth for a 1-0 advantage as he reached on an error, moved to second on Hernandez's sacrifice bunt and eventually scored on a wild pitch.

 

- For the second time in as many games, the bullpen tallied a victory as Rogen followed up Grant Townsend's effort Friday with his first win. Harrison Smith allowed one base runner in a scoreless eighth inning and Stout finished off the Utes with a perfect ninth.

 

- Preseason All-American Miguel Ausua started and went six innings for ORU allowing three earned runs on five hits with four strikeouts.

 

- With the victory, Head Coach Ryan Folmar evened his record against teams from Power Five conferences at 25-25, including an 11-3 mark in home games.
